We use an HSA- our family of 7 is less than $600 per month, and our deductable is $2,500. Everything is covered at 100% after deductable. So if something terrible happens to someone we just pay the $2,500. Plus if you don't meet your deductable you have a little money socked away in your HSA (basically like an IRA).
